Background

As a financial advisor for social media influencers, Zach Nelson, CFP®, MBA is the first line of defense for these entrepreneurs. He designs financial planning that helps shield them from the ups and downs an unstable cash flow can bring. The analysis they work on together is designed to enable them to still achieve their life goals taking into account the risk of an abrupt termination.

His realm of work is not limited just to social media stars. Rock House Financial has an emphasis on charitable giving, and he is happy to speak with anyone who has questions about how to give to others and arrange their finances to enable carrying on of their legacy through charitable donations.

Zach graduated from Utah Valley University with a bachelor’s degree in Personal Financial Planning and a master’s degree in Business Administration from the Woodbury School of Business. Shortly after graduation, he joined the Rock House Financial team, became a CERTIFIED FINANCIAL PLANNERTM, and a licensed Investment Advisor Representative.

His favorite part of the job is getting to know each clients’ individual goals and then helping them prepare, financially, to meet them. He enjoys the fact that each case is different because everyone has their own past experiences that have shaped who they are today.

While on the UVU Men’s Basketball team, he won two conference championships and is now the only player in UVU history to have at least 1,000 points, 500 rebounds, and 200 assists. With his competitive basketball career now over, Zach spends a lot of his evenings and weekends outdoors with his wife Prezley, their two dogs, and their daughter Zuri.
